I use Pledge acrylic floor polish as my general varnish / oil sealer / gloss layer for decals and then matt everything down at the end with Windsor and Newton non-yellowing acrylic varnish, mainly because both are available in large bottles for way less than a tiny pot !

Both go thru the airbrush just fine with a little thinning ( I use a mix of water and Tamiya thinners, don't exactly know why but it seems to work)
You will need to be careful to clean the airbrush with thinners after or it will be properly gummed up.

To answer your question: Badly! lol. The shape is called a truncated cone, simply half of one. It's getting the size of the nested circles right.
I cba to type out the math here, here is a site that will do it for you :http://craig-russell.co.uk/demos/cone_calculator/

although you have to take into account the thickness of the plasticard, I'm using 0.5mm and I also added the little tabs on the end.

As for chipping on the yellow, have you considered/tried Sponge Weathering? It's a simple as it sounds; take some sponge or scouring pad, mix up a suitable colour (I like black/brown with a hint of metallic for yellow) and lightly dab it on the required area. Once that's done, put a veeery thin highlight around the larger chips to look like peeling paint and you're golden.
